Darlington Provincial Park is a provincial park in Ontario, Canada. It is located just south of Highway 401 in the city of Bowmanville. A small park, the topography is dominated by gentle hills formed by a terminal moraine deposited by glaciers at the end of the last Ice Age.

Darlington Nuclear Generating Station is a Canadian nuclear power station located on the north shore of Lake Ontario in Bowmanville, Ontario. It is a large nuclear facility comprising four CANDU nuclear reactors with a total output of 3,512 MWe when all units are online, providing about 20 percent of Ontario's electricity needs, enough to serve a city of two million people. Bowmanville is a community of approximately 60,000 people located in the Municipality of Clarington, Durham Region, Ontario, Canada. It is approximately 75 km east of Toronto, and 15 km east of Oshawa along Highway 2. Bowmanville is situated 7 km northeast of Darlington Station.

Oshawa is a city of 160,000 people in southern Ontario, 50 km east of Toronto. Oshawa has been a centre of Canada's automotive industry since the early 20th century, and is home to the Canadian Automotive Museum.
